The Main Takeaway
It’s completely normal to want to be loved and appreciated. But while we should aim for these things in our relationships, it is wise to remember only Jesus can truly satisfy. It is only Christ the Lord who can truly give us peace, joy and rest for our souls (Psalm 42:2).
While the driving force behind your addiction may try to make you feel like it is the answer to your deepest hurts and disappointments, there isn’t a drug, hobby, meal or person on the planet that has the capacity to fix you or make you whole (Isaiah 58:11).
